What is Generative AI?

Generative AI is a revolutionary type of artificial intelligence that can create new content, from text and images to music and code. Unlike traditional AI that analyzes data, generative AI produces original outputs based on what it has learned.

How Does Generative AI Work?

Generative AI uses machine learning models trained on massive amounts of data. The most advanced systems use:

  • Neural networks that mimic the human brain
  • Deep learning with many layers of processing
  • Techniques like transformers for understanding context

When you give a prompt to generative AI, it predicts what should come next based on patterns in its training data. For example, tools like ChatGPT generate human-like text one word at a time.

Common Types of Generative AI

Text Generators: Create articles, stories, or code (e.g., ChatGPT, Bard)

Image Generators: Produce photos and artwork (e.g., DALL-E, Midjourney)

Audio Generators: Compose music or mimic voices (e.g., Jukebox, VALL-E)

Video Generators: Create or enhance video content

Why is Generative AI Important?

Generative AI is transforming how we create content. It helps with:

  • Speeding up creative processes
  • Generating ideas and prototypes
  • Personalizing content at scale
  • Automating repetitive tasks

Businesses use it for marketing, product design, and customer service. Students and researchers use it as a learning tool. The possibilities are growing every day.

Limitations and Concerns

While powerful, generative AI has challenges:

  • Can produce inaccurate or biased information
  • Raises copyright questions about generated content
  • May impact jobs in creative fields
  • Requires large amounts of computing power

Experts recommend verifying AI-generated content and using these tools responsibly.
